What are neo-tribes? Who made the concept?
Loose groups of young people with similar tastes, made by Maffesoli
What do zombie categories say? Who made this?
Some concepts live on in society when they are actually dead. Created by Beck
What do postmodernists think about the relationship between social class and youth cultures?
They believe it does not influence youth cultures
How are neo-tribes different to youth cultures?
No deep committment No fixed membership
What did Polhemus say about youths picking and mixing things from cultures?
Supermarket of style
What did Sharkey find?
Found five ‘tribes’ that had their own distinct tastes
What did Sharkey suggest from his findings?
Young people don’t join one group with set behaviours but there are collections of loose youth cultures
What did Bennet claim?
Modern youth cultures are ‘pick and mix’ meaning they don’t commit to the same norms and values
Which sociologist did research in Raves in Newcastle?
Bennet
What did he find in the raves? Is this a fluid culture?
Neo-tribes were based music and fashion but no shared value, so they are fluid.
What does Thornton say about club cultures?
They are taste cultures where people share a music style
What is subcultural capital? What does it do? Who created the term?
Describes knowing what is “in” or “out” in music and fashion used to gain status. Created by Thornton

What are hybrid youth cultures? Who created the concept?
Ones that fuse together different cultural influences. Made by Livingstone
What is an example of a hybrid youth culture? What does it take inspiration from?
Grime. London-based youth culture that fuses American hip-hop with it
Who created the concept of a global village?
McLuhan
What is the global village?
The idea that social, economic and tech change have made the world more connected
How does the global village affect young people?
They are able to choose from a range of styles
Who made the idea of ‘triumph of style over substance’?
Polhemus
What is ‘triumph of style over substance’?
States that young people only pick what they want the most, not caring about it’s depth
How have bedroom cultures changed?
Better technology allows people to be connected with the whole world
What does Livingstone say about new bedroom cultures?
They are media rich areas where people organise their social time online
